Steve Vai on New Album with Joe Satriani, BEAT Tour, Prince, David Lee Roth and More


Steve Vai is back to chat all things guitar with GI’s Jonathan Graham as he reunites with Joe Satriani and Eric Johnson for G3 Reunion Live. Steve shares his memories of playing G3 shows over the years, working on the new SATCH/VAI album, and the challenges of making Robert Fripp’s guitar parts his own while on tour with BEAT.

Vai also reflects on his dramatic debut performance of “For the Love of God” at the 1991 Guitar Legends festival, the David Lee Roth reunion that almost happened, crafting “Eugene’s Trick Bag,” and what it was like stepping into the studio with Public Image Ltd. Plus, the truth behind the long-rumoured Prince jam session—and how one of his own tracks mysteriously ended up on a Prince bootleg in Japan.

All that and a whole lot more in this exclusive interview with Steve Vai.
